Five hundred square kilometers. This is the area taken over by the Ukrainian army in the south of the country in barely a week, according to Volodymyr Zelensky. The major objective is in sight: Kherson, regional capital of an oblast theoretically annexed by Moscow. Russian forces took the city in the first days of the war, distributed Russian passports to the inhabitants there before organizing a "referendum", and reconnected it to Crimea."It is the largest city taken earlier in the...

Increasing contamination. Three months after the appearance of the first western cases of monkey pox, France has so far identified 2,749 cases, according to the latest figures from Public Health France. That is about 10% of the cases reported in recent months worldwide.And if people at risk are eligible for preventive vaccination, on the side of associations, we consider the vaccination campaign too slow to contain the spread of the virus, with, in sight, the fear that the epidemic escapes...
